The wooden seating, the browns and blacks with those shiny yellow lights surely makes this place a good one. A great idea to enjoy some good cocktails or beers with great food, this is the place to be. The service is usually quick but it tends to slow down on the weekends. The menu offers some really good choice of appetizers and mains. There is a huge list of appetizers and there is not anything new per se but you will certainly love the familiar grub. Try the 'Soya Chaap' which is the faux meat for Vegetarians, it is succulent, spicy and everything nice. Interestingly, there is a 'Sichuan Style Chicken Tikka' - a very nice and unique rendition on a classic Chicken Tikka. The drinks are quite nice and creative touch with good play of flavours keeps everyone curious. The mains include 'Hyderabadi Murgh' which is a classic and tastes great. If you love rice, the 'Mutton Biryani' is a rather delicious one, some proper balance going in there. You might want to stick to the 'Chocolate Brownie' for your sweet tooth.
